Автор Тема: Скачивание файла в конкретную папку InetGet  (Прочитано 2313 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н BuZZinga [?]

  • Новичок
  • *
  • Сообщений: 13
  • Репутация: 0
  • Пол: Мужской
    • Награды
  • Версия AutoIt: 3.3.14.0
Доброй ночи дорогие друзья!
Столкнулся с проблемой... Имеется следующий код
Код: AutoIt [Выделить]
#include <Inet.au3>
#include <IE.au3>
#include <GUIConstants.au3>
#include <ButtonConstants.au3>
#include <EditConstants.au3>
#include <GUIConstantsEx.au3>
#include <WindowsConstants.au3>

#Region ### START Koda GUI section ### Form=
$Form1 = GUICreate("Trevco Downloader by Buzzinga", 381, 173, 192, 124)
$NM = GUICtrlCreateInput("Enter CSV", 96, 48, 185, 21)
$Download = GUICtrlCreateButton("Download", 152, 88, 81, 25)
GUISetState(@SW_SHOW)
#EndRegion ### END Koda GUI section ###

While 1
    $nMsg = GUIGetMsg()
    Switch $nMsg
        Case $GUI_EVENT_CLOSE
            Exit
        Case $Download
            $Get = GUICtrlRead($NM)



$Att = InetRead ('http://images.trevcoinc.com/JPEG/'&$Get&'-ATT.jpg')
If StringInStr ($Att, 'Server',0) Then
InetGet ('http://images.trevcoinc.com/JPEG/'&$Get&'-ATT.jpg', @ScriptDir&'\'&$Get&'\'&ATT1.jpg')
EndIf

$At = InetRead ('
http://images.trevcoinc.com/JPEG/'&$Get&'-AT.jpg')
If StringInStr ($At, '
Server') Then
EndIf
InetGet ('
http://images.trevcoinc.com/JPEG/'&$Get&'-AT.jpg', @ScriptDir&'\'&$Get&'\'&'AT.jpg')


$Ha = InetRead ('
http://images.trevcoinc.com/JPEG/'&$Get&'-HA.jpg')
If StringInStr ($Ha, '
Server') Then
EndIf
InetGet ('
http://images.trevcoinc.com/JPEG/'&$Get&'-HA.jpg', @ScriptDir&'\'&$Get&'\'&'HA.jpg' )

    EndSwitch

WEnd

Но данным скриптом ну никак не получается скачать файл в папку с именем "$Get"..
Подскажите, в чем состоит проблема?

$Get для теста: GL265
Заранее благодарен!

Русское сообщество AutoIt

Скачивание файла в конкретную папку InetGet
« Отправлен: Март 16, 2016, 01:14:31 »

Помечен как лучший ответ пользователем BuZZinga Отправлен Март 16, 2016, 12:53:38

Онлайн joiner [?]

  • Расмус-бродяга
  • Локальный модератор
  • *
  • Сообщений: 2959
  • Репутация: 494
  • Пол: Мужской
    • Награды
  • Версия AutoIt: 3.3.12.0
можно сделать так
(нажмите для показа/скрытия)
если ты хочешь именно свой вариант, то сначала нужно создать папку, куда будет грузиться картинки - DirCreate()
ну и , для приличия, закрывать соединения
Были времена, когда солнце было ярче, трава зеленее, а водка сорокоградуснее

Оффлайн BuZZinga [?]

  • Новичок
  • *
  • Сообщений: 13

  • Автор темы
  • Репутация: 0
  • Пол: Мужской
    • Награды
  • Версия AutoIt: 3.3.14.0
Огромное спасибо, проблема решилась)

Русское сообщество AutoIt

Re: Скачивание файла в конкретную папку InetGet
« Ответ #2 Отправлен: Март 16, 2016, 12:54:50 »

 

Похожие темы

  Тема / Автор Ответов Последний ответ
5 Ответов
4379 Просмотров
Последний ответ Август 04, 2016, 07:18:58
от tubsids
4 Ответов
3612 Просмотров
Последний ответ Май 29, 2012, 22:37:28
от lirikmel
0 Ответов
2329 Просмотров
Последний ответ Июнь 17, 2012, 08:42:43
от ivsatel
2 Ответов
2746 Просмотров
Последний ответ Июль 12, 2012, 17:09:05
от _Lexa98_
6 Ответов
4821 Просмотров
Последний ответ Август 10, 2012, 10:56:55
от real_sm
8 Ответов
4195 Просмотров
Последний ответ Июль 30, 2012, 08:02:45
от zlo-kazan
1 Ответов
1291 Просмотров
Последний ответ Ноябрь 06, 2013, 02:08:10
от valldar
13 Ответов
3639 Просмотров
Последний ответ Ноябрь 09, 2015, 14:17:31
от InnI
0 Ответов
1420 Просмотров
Последний ответ Июль 01, 2016, 14:53:22
от k377
5 Ответов
843 Просмотров
Последний ответ Август 15, 2017, 12:26:14
от Garrett